  • Patent number: 11496850
    Abstract: The present invention relates to a spatial arrangement for optimizing the broadcasting of a sound signal and thus replacing the conventional stereo systems. For this purpose, the spatial arrangement is capable of broadcasting a spatialized sound signal, the spatialized sound signal comprising N mutually distinct audio signals, N being an integer strictly greater than 3, and the spatial arrangement comprising a set of N sound broadcasting devices predominantly distributed over the entire width of a scene. Each sound broadcasting device receives an audio signal of which it will amplify and broadcast the transmitted sound. In particular, each sound broadcasting device is specifically capable of reproducing and preserving the characteristics of the sound transmitted by the audio signal received, in particular the sound frequency bands and the sound intensity of the frequency bands of the audio signal.

  • Patent number: 11463807
    Abstract: The present invention relates to a sound diffusion device (300) comprising a single box (310) and, in this single box (310), at least two superimposed high-frequency acoustic sources (320), and a plurality of superimposed medium and/or low-frequency sources (330) and arranged to the left and/or to the right of the high-frequency acoustic sources (320), the high-frequency acoustic sources (320) being coupled individually to a wave guide (340) so as to generate a vertical wave front with a fixed non-constant curvature. Such a device (300) makes it possible to minimise discontinuities between the acoustic sources providing high quality sound diffusion (no parasite lobe), to considerably reduce the weight and the cost of manufacturing and also enables rapid installation which does not require the angular adjustment of each acoustic source relative to one another contrary to existing devices.

  • Patent number: 11265671
    Abstract: A signal processing system and method is disclosed for applying time-based effects to an N-channel audio input signal for reproduction on a set of loudspeakers having a predetermined configuration. A first M-channel audio signal is produced from the N-channel audio input signal. Each channel of the first M-channel audio signal is associated with a subset of the loudspeakers. A second M-channel audio signal is produced from the first M-channel audio signal according to an M×M matrix, each element aij in the M×M matrix including a delay term. A minimum value of the delay term in each element aij is determined according to a distance between at least two loudspeakers in at least one of the i and j subsets of loudspeakers and according to minimum delay value of a time-based delay effect applied to each channel of the second M-channel audio signal. A K-channel audio signal is then produced from the or each second M-channel audio signal.

  • Patent number: 11006211
    Abstract: The invention relates to a sound broadcasting device comprising a high-frequency section including at least one high-frequency acoustic source (SHF), and a medium-frequency section including at least two medium-frequency sources (SMF), the acoustic sources (SHF, SMF) being vertically superposed, where the medium-frequency section comprises a lower sub-section, arranged below the high-frequency section and comprising at least one medium-frequency acoustic source (SMF), and an upper sub-section, arranged above the high-frequency section and comprising at least one medium-frequency acoustic source (SMF), where the vertical directivity of the high-frequency section has an incline, relative to the horizontal (H), that is substantially equal to the incline (?MF) of the vertical directivity of the medium-frequency section relative to the horizontal (H), so that the overall vertical directivity of the device has a non-zero incline (?Dir) relative to the horizontal (H).

  • Patent number: 10939223
    Abstract: A method for producing a multi-channel audio signal from one or more sound object signals is disclosed, where, for each sound object signal a plurality of width signals is produced, the amplitudes of the width signals following a substantially Gaussian distribution. The width signals are processed to produce a plurality of pan signals which are mapped to at least one channel. Each channel in the audio signal is produced by combining the pan signals from each sound object. An apparatus for reproducing such a multi-channel audio signal is also disclosed, in which a plurality of first loudspeakers are provided spaced around a first arc forward of a predetermined listening zone, each of the first loudspeakers facing towards the listening zone and substantially equidistant therefrom. A plurality of second loudspeakers are provided spaced around a second arc behind the listening zone, each of the second loudspeakers facing towards the listening zone.
